530 Mr. Deasy asked the Minister for Communications, Marine and Natural Resources his intentions regarding the raising of the trawler, Père Charles;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[10075/07]
View answerResponsibility for maritime safety issues, including search and rescue and salvage responses in the marine environment rests with my colleague the Minister for Transport. As such, any questions relating to the raising of the fishing vessel Père Charles are a matter for the Minister for Transport.
